Hi Stephenie, what was your thought process behind starting your own business?
I spent over 30 years in the corporate world, and when my Director was laid off that I really had respect for and enjoyed working for , I started really contemplating what I would do if I found myself in the same situation. Throughout my career, I had always had a passion for helping people look and feel beautiful, naturally—from the inside out. Growing up with skin issues made me especially passionate about this, and I knew it was something I truly cared about.
I realized that if I were laid off, I wouldn’t want to go back into the corporate world. I wanted to follow my passion, and this felt like the perfect opportunity to do so. In 2020, during the pandemic, I took the leap and went to school. It was a time when we all needed self-care more than ever, and I knew this was the right path for me.

If you had a friend visiting you, what are some of the local spots you’d want to take them around to?
Funny you ask this, because it’s actually happening right now! If my best friend were visiting, I’d start by taking her to my absolute favorite Mexican spots: Valle Luna Mexican Food or Los Dos Molinos—both have incredible food and margaritas that are not to be missed.
Next, we’d hit up Old Town Scottsdale for some shopping, and I’d definitely take her to Urbana, a cute local boutique with all the best Arizona-made goodies.
For dinner, I’d treat her to a cozy, charming spot called Arcadia Farms—great food and even better vibes. Then, on Sunday, we’d take a scenic drive to Sedona, and do the Devil’s Bridge Trail—it’s one of the most iconic hikes there, with amazing views that’ll take her breath away. After the hike, we’d visit the Chapel of the Holy Cross for some peace and serenity.
We’d end the day at Mariposa, a stunning restaurant with not only amazing food but also a view and ambiance that makes you feel like you’re in another world. Perfect end to an unforgettable weekend.
